Accident Summary Nr: 202076659 - Employee in Training Receives Burns

Accident Summary Nr: 202076659 -- Report ID: 0453730 -- Event Date: 07/19/2005

Abstract: On July 19, 2005, Employee #1 was being trained on equipment. He came back from a break and instead of reporting to his trainer, took it upon himself to unload a washer and place the load into the dryer. The load was not fully cleaned and when he turned on the dryer, the chemicals flashed and the door blew open. Employee #1 was exposed to heat and steam, and was burned.
